The Hialeah Thoroughbreds will challenge the Varela Vipers at 3:30 p.m. on Thursday. Hialeah will be looking to extend their current five-game winning streak.
Hialeah is on a roll after a high-stakes playoff matchup on Tuesday. They never let American get on the board and left with a 4-0 win. Give Hialeah's defense some credit: that's the team's fourth straight shutout.
Meanwhile, after soaring to six goals the game before, Varela was a bit more limited in their match on Thursday. They came up short against Coral Reef, falling 4-1. While losing is never fun, Varela can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' Florida soccer rankings (they are ranked 319th, while Coral Reef are ranked 114th).
Hialeah's victory bumped their record up to 10-4. As for Varela, their defeat dropped their record down to 8-5-2.
Hialeah suffered a grim 4-1 defeat to Varela when the teams last played back in December of 2024. Can the Thoroughbreds avenge their loss or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
